Projects without PDM [A1, A2, B1, B2]

In the event that there is no PDM available on the ES, another option is to use
import.
To do this, use a 3rd computer with the same STEP7/PCS 7 installation of the
original ES, plus the PDM installation (including the imported device catalog).
The following minimum PDM licenses are required:
PDM Basic License
One PDM Tag license for each field device.
Procedure
1. Archive the current multi-project or project and copy it to the 3rd computer with
the PDM installation.
2. Open the ES project on the 3rd computer.
3. Open PDM for a device so that the network structure is created in PDM.
4. Copy the PDM-MS project from Chapter 7.1 or 7.2 to this 3rd computer and
open it.
5. Open the Process Device Network View in this PDM MS Project.
6. Right-click the plant bus ("PROFINET Network") and select "SIMATIC PDM >
Import from HWK Station" from the context menu.
For this, the same subnet ID as in the ES project must be set in the properties
of the plant bus.
7. Select the ES project (see step 3.) and confirm the selection with "OK".
8. Start the import by clicking "Import"
9. Copy the PDM MS project back to the PDM MS.
